Exactly on the 140th anniversary of Franz Liszt’s death, on 31 July, the Liszt Museum announced its new, autumn matinée season. The museum welcomes audiences every Saturday at 11 a.m. for a unique concert in the Chamber Music Hall of the Old Academy of Music from September.

A new temporary exhibition has opened – as it does every year – in November. It explores the work of Franz Liszt’s friend and chamber partner, the violinist and composer Jenő Hubay.

In June, members of staff from the Liszt Museum travelled to Paris on a professional visit. During their stay, Director Máté Cselényi, Anna Peternák, Blanka Pászthory and Diána Mátrai visited several cultural institutions with the aim of establishing future collaborations.
